Is It Ok To Sand Carbon Fiber? [Solved]

Well, I’ll tell ya, sanding the carbon fiber weave was a no-no. So I just used 320 grit sandpaper to take off the clear coat and then 400 grit to even it out. Let me tell you, the clear coat on that wing was pretty bad and there were still some marks after I finished.
